SG-710ECK 37.5000MC0 Working Principle
SG-710ECK 37.5000MC0 oscillators are devices that convert an electrical signal into a periodic waveform. They work by generating an alternating current with a specific frequency and, depending on the type of oscillator, with a specific amplitude characteristic. The basic working principle of an oscillator is based on two processes. The first process is amplification, and the second process is feedback.
In an ideal state, the price of an oscillator in the form of a voltage wave changes from 0 volts to the limit voltage of the power supply and back to 0 volts in a continuous manner, and the current also changes from 0 (zero) to the limit current of power supply and back to zero (zero) in a continuous manner. In the process of amplification, if the gain of the system is greater than 1 (one), then the input-output characteristic curve of the system will form an oscillation. The second process is to use an external circuit or device to provide feedback to establish a positive feedback loop. In this way, an oscillator can work.
